Generalized Swanson Models and their solutions

We analyze a class of non-Hermitian quadratic Hamiltonians, which are of the form H = A†A + αA2 + βA† 2, where α , β are real constants, with α 6= β, and A† and A are generalized creation and annihilation operators. Thus these Hamiltonians may be classified as generalized Swanson models. It is shown that the eigenenergies are real for a certain range of values of the parameters. A similarity transformation ρ, mapping the non-Hermitian Hamiltonian H to a Hermitian one h, is also obtained. It is shown that H and h share identical energies. As explicit examples, the solutions of a couple of models based on the trigonometric RosenMorse I and the hyperbolic Rosen-Morse II type potentials are obtained. We also study the case when the non-Hermitian Hamiltonian is PT symmetric.
